It is a fraud prevention technique.

It sounds like a pretty clear cut case of your referrals need to rebill for a minimum term of 90 days to get the referral credit. This is standard (more common than not) for commissions at the hosting level, as well as the real world in general if you do any sort of commissioned sales. All new sign ups need to rebill for a minimum of 30/60/90 days before credit is paid. If they cancel prior, you do not get the green.

Regarding the "unlimited hosting" this has really been beaten to death. I hoped that, especially on this board with more experienced webmasters, it would be clear by now that unlimited bandwidth and space does not mean unlimited CPU and RAM. Why would any ever need need a VPS or dedicated server then. Really? Not to mention the fact that we are VERY upfront about what unlimited means on our website, unlike many of our competitors AND offer an option to protect your services.
